Output e741cd8862ddfa3d7fa09a17626a598366ddf8e523b7ec90180ea116e033a42a:0

value
1002797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c77ea33e1c0700b0828f220262edf6db135c73a0 OP_EQUAL
address
3Ksr6f5WTJW2dZH1AZm3pbWedtDemffBEt
transaction
e741cd8862ddfa3d7fa09a17626a598366ddf8e523b7ec90180ea116e033a42a
confirmations
324895
spent
true